lml,

While I do agree with many of your points I have a comment regarding this observation:
<<What we saw today was the market's surprise to the "unexpected" profitability problems Schroeder & Co. encountered this Q with products falling within its "core business.">>

Unexpected?? yes but to who? certainly it couldnt have been Mr Schroeder. Based on a shareholder letter written 2 months into the quarter I find it hard to believe that up until the last month he had no idea how this quarter was measuring up. This was alot more than a slight miss ...where talking 70%!!! To their shareholders? definitely, they could only go on that guidance which was provided them. This in what proved to be IMO a grossly inaccurate assessment of the company's prospects for this last quarter (and probably this quarter as well) coupled with the fact the he was selling off stock at this time gives me great pause.
Certainly were all here to make money but this has become a question of ethics. I had to ask myself whether or not this company deserves my investment..its about basic trust..would you loan your money to someone you didnt trust even if you thought it might be profitable?
